Scott Austin, Thank You For Coming Out

In this week’s episode of the Gay City News podcast “Thank You For Coming Out,” creator and host Dubbs Weinblatt (they/ them/ theirs) welcomes Scott Austin (he/him/his), who is a Brooklyn-based theater teacher. He also works as a teaching artist with Ping Chong + Co. and performs improv comedy around New York. Scott received his MA from NYU Steinhardt. He knows a pretty good joke about a penguin.

As queer people, we are constantly coming out, and each coming out story is unique in its blend of humor, heartache, worry, and wonder. “Thank You For Coming Out,” inspired by Dubbs’ beloved live comedy show of the same name, pairs them as host with lesbian, gay, trans, bi, non-binary, and more members of the queer community to discuss their coming out stories.
